Summary

The Voting Rights Act of 1965, as amended, ensures that no citizen's right to vote is abridged or denied due to race, color, or language minority group status. The Act gives the U.S. Office of Personnel Management (OPM) responsibility for providing Federal Observers to monitor the election process in areas designated by the U.S. Attorney General.

OPM particularly needs observers who can speak, understand, and translate the minority languages covered under the Voting Rights Act (i.e., the languages of persons who are Asian American, Native American, Alaskan Natives, or of Spanish heritage), with strong writing skills (in English).

We are looking for applicants who can speak, read, understand, and translate into English, one of the following languages:

  • Yup'ik
  • Gwich'in
Applicants will be required to undergo a separate language assessment interview.



Please note:  Any applicant appointed as a Federal Voting Rights Observer does not acquire personal competitive status on the basis of this appointment.

Those Who May Not Be Considered

The following persons are not eligible for this position:

    Current employees of the U.S. Department of Justice or one of its sub-agencies
    Full-time employees of the Office of Personnel Management
    Relatives of OPM's full-time Voting Rights Program staff

    Duties


    As a Voting Rights Observer, you will be responsible for monitoring and accurately reporting all election activities in polling places, which include poll procedures, voter assistance, and vote tallying. Other duties include, but are not limited to, conducting interviews to gather information, documenting observations, writing and editing detailed reports of daily events, and maintaining impartiality during elections.
